Adjustable Voltage Settings: Adjustable voltage settings allow users to customize the heat applied to the oil in the cartridge. This affects the flavor and vapor production. A battery with multiple voltage options enables consumers to experiment and find their preferred setting. Most quality batteries provide a range between 3.3V to 4.8V.
-
Battery Capacity (mAh): Battery capacity is measured in milliampere-hours (mAh) and indicates how long the battery will last between charges. A higher mAh rating means longer use. For example, a 650mAh battery typically lasts longer than a 350mAh battery, making it more suitable for frequent users.
-
Preheat Function: The preheat function warms up the cartridge before use. This feature helps ensure that thicker oils vaporize more easily. Users often benefit from this feature in winter or when using higher viscosity oils.
-
Size and Design: The size and design of the battery contribute to portability and usability. Slim, lightweight batteries are easier to carry. A well-designed battery may also offer ergonomic grips that enhance the user experience.
-
Safety Features: Safety features protect against overcharging, short-circuiting, and overheating. Look for batteries with automatic shut-off functions or protection circuits that enhance safe usage, decreasing the risk of accidents.
-
Compatibility with Cartridges: A good 510 thread battery should be compatible with a variety of cartridges. Ensuring broad compatibility will allow users to switch between different oils without needing multiple batteries.
-
LED Indicator Lights: LED indicator lights provide feedback on battery status. They often signal when the battery is charging, when it’s fully charged, or when the power is on. Clear indicators enhance user convenience and prevent misuse.
-
Charging Options: Consider the charging options available. Some batteries offer USB charging, while others may include wireless or fast-charging features. Versatile charging options increase ease of use, particularly for users on the go.

Why is Voltage Control Essential for a 510 Thread Battery?
Voltage control is essential for a 510 thread battery because it ensures optimal performance and safety during use. Proper voltage levels enhance vapor production and flavor, while also extending the battery’s lifespan.
According to the American National Standards Institute (ANSI), voltage is defined as the electrical potential difference between two points. This definition highlights the importance of maintaining the correct voltage to avoid damage and ensure efficiency.
Voltage control prevents overheating and potential battery failure. When a battery operates at the correct voltage, it delivers consistent power, leading to a stable heat output. Excessive voltage can cause coils to burn out or lead to a poor user experience by creating harsh vapor. Conversely, too low voltage can result in inadequate heating, yielding lesser vapor.
In technical terms, voltage refers to the pressure of electric charge in a circuit. For 510 thread batteries, this electrical pressure must be compatible with the resistance of the connected cartridge. The resistance is measured in ohms, which quantifies how much a material opposes the flow of electricity. These concepts are crucial for ensuring the battery and cartridge work synergistically.
The mechanisms involved in voltage control include built-in regulation features within the battery. Many modern 510 batteries have adjustable voltage settings, allowing users to select the ideal range based on their preferences and cartridge requirements. For example, lower resistance cartridges may require higher voltage settings to generate sufficient heat.
Specific conditions that contribute to voltage control issues include using incompatible cartridges, exposing the battery to extreme temperatures, or allowing lithium-ion cells to discharge too much. For instance, using a high-resistance cartridge with a low voltage setting may result in a poor user experience, while operating a low-resistance cartridge at a high voltage can cause burning or leakage.

How Do I Troubleshoot Common Issues with My 510 Thread Cart Battery?
To troubleshoot common issues with a 510 thread cart battery, you can follow several key steps to identify and resolve malfunctions effectively.
Check the battery charge: Ensure the battery is fully charged. Many problems stem from insufficient power. Connect the battery to the charger and look for indicator lights. A steady light often means charging, while a blinking light may indicate a full charge or an issue with the connection.
Inspect the connection: Examine the threads on both the cartridge and the battery. Clean any debris or residue with a cotton swab dipped in rubbing alcohol. Proper connection ensures the device can actively engage without interruptions.
Test the cartridge: Verify that the cartridge is functioning correctly. If possible, attach a different cartridge to the battery. If the new cartridge works, the original cartridge may be faulty.
Check for overheating: Monitor the battery for excessive heat during use or charging. If it becomes too hot, cease operation immediately to prevent damage. Allowing the battery to cool may solve overheating issues.
Look for battery lifespan: Consider the age of the battery. Most 510 thread batteries have a limited number of charge cycles. If the battery fails to hold a charge despite being fully charged, it may be nearing the end of its lifespan.
Review the use of compatible devices: Ensure you are using compatible cartridges designed for 510 thread batteries. Mismatched components can lead to performance issues.
Examine the settings: If the battery has adjustable voltage or temperature settings, experiment with different levels. Sometimes lower settings can provide a better experience with specific cartridges.
These troubleshooting steps can help users identify the sources of issues with their 510 thread cart batteries effectively.
